Aether

/ˈiːθə/

noun

noun: aether

  1. a very rarefied and highly elastic substance formerly believed to permeate all space, including the interstices between the particles of matter, and to be the medium whose vibrations constituted light and other electromagnetic radiation.

  2. the clear sky; the upper regions of air beyond the clouds.
